One of the key elements of this European plan is saving energy. In its proposal, the Commission stresses efficiency measures that in the long term will lower the cost of bills, to which we should add the high ecosystemic cost generated by the use of non-renewable and polluting energy. Therefore, from LIFE ECODIGESTION 2.0 we will implement a biogas technology on demand, where the energy produced will be just enough to carry out the proper operation, performance and process that requires it. In addition, within our specific objectives, we highlight the increase of up to 14% in biogas production with the same amount of added cosubstrate by means of the most favourable dosing of waste and mixtures, maintaining the stability of the system.

One of the most important advantages of successfully implementing and replicating a project like LIFE ECODIGESTION 2.0, aligned with this European plan, is the reduction of greenhouse gases. The European Climate Law and legally binding climate commitments aim to reduce net greenhouse gas emissions by at least 55% by 2030. According to calculations by the LIFE ECODIGESTION2.0 technical team, emission reductions with this technology can be up to 24,343 tonnes of CO2 equivalent (CO2-eq)/year and other acid rain promoting gases, such as SO4 and NOX, by 8,977 kg and 6,465 kg per year.
